AEAS is located in Melbourne, Australia and provides a comprehensive assessment service for international school students applying for entry into Australian and New Zealand schools. The AEAS assessment includes English language proficiency tests (in five skill areas), mathematical reasoning and general ability tests. AEAS testing is available worldwide. Casual Test Administrator position - Hanoi, Vietnam
- Test Administrators must be available on a casual basis.
- Test sessions are in Hanoi and are currently scheduled on a monthly basis.
- Students sitting the AEAS test are applying for entry into Years 4 -12 in Australian schools and Years 5-13 in New Zealand schools. The Test Administrator will be responsible for managing the arrival and check-in of students and invigilating the written components of the AEAS Test, which takes up to four hours under examination conditions. Speaking tests and interviews occur after the written tests, are conducted individually and take up to 15 minutes per student. Once testing has been completed, the Test Administrator returns assessments, test materials and other relevant documents to the AEAS Melbourne office for marking and report writing.
- Test Administrators are renumerated for this task and time.
- The payment for post-test tasks depends on the number of students in each test session.
- Training and ongoing support is provided to Test Administrators from our Head Office in Melbourne.
Successful applicants will meet the Key Selection Criteria and will preferably have experience in testing or examination administration under formal conditions.
An understanding of issues in successful test administration and test material security practices will be an advantage.
